VideoStitch vs Adobe Animate
psychology AI Verdict
VideoStitch excels in creating seamless 360-degree videos with its advanced AI stitching technology, which has been used to produce some of the most immersive VR content available today. Adobe Animate, on the other hand, shines as a versatile tool for vector graphics and animations, offering powerful features that are essential for web developers and designers aiming to create interactive content. While VideoStitch is specifically designed for 360-degree video creation, it falls short in areas such as animation tools and integration with other software.
Conversely, Adobe Animate lacks the specialized capabilities of VideoStitch but excels in providing a comprehensive suite of tools for vector graphics and animations. The choice between these two depends on your specific needs: if you are focused on 360-degree video creation, VideoStitch is undoubtedly superior; however, if you require robust animation tools for web development or design projects, Adobe Animate is the clear winner.

compare Feature Comparison
| Feature | VideoStitch | Adobe Animate |
|---|---|---|
| AI Stitching Technology | Advanced AI stitching technology that ensures seamless 360-degree videos. | No AI stitching capabilities, focuses on vector graphics and animations. |
| Cloud Services | Supports large-scale projects with cloud services for collaboration and storage. | Does not offer cloud services; relies on local machine resources. |
| Collaboration Features | Robust collaboration features, including real-time editing and project sharing. | Limited collaboration features compared to VideoStitch's advanced options. |
| Animation Tools | Basic animation tools for simple 360-degree video transitions. | Advanced vector graphics and animation tools with a wide range of effects and features. |
| Integration Capabilities | Limited integration with other software, focusing on its specialized task. | Extensive integration with other Adobe products, making it easier to use in a broader creative workflow. |
| User Interface | User-friendly but complex for advanced users working on large-scale projects. | Intuitive and user-friendly interface that caters well to both beginners and experienced users. |
